Driver hospitalized

by Joy Ufford

A mangled Looney Construction dump truck lies on its side Tuesday evening south of Daniel Junction on Highway 191 after rolling three-quarters of a roll, according to Wyoming Highway Patrol Trooper Josh Lengerich. Mike Looney of Daniel was driving the dump truck northbound and it rolled after he swerved to the right to get around a UPS truck that was stopped in the same lane to turn left into the Seven Miles River Ranch drive, the trooper said. Looney was transported to St. John’s Hospital in Jackson where he was listed in “fair” condition Wednesday, according to hospital spokeswoman Karen Connelly.
